Ingredients
For the Chicken
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 2 tbsp olive oil
For the Sauce
- 1/4 cup unsalted butter
- 2 tsp honey
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/2 tsp black pepper
For Garnish
- 1/4 cup chicken broth
- 1 tbsp chopped parsley (for garnish)
How to Make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et
Step 1: Prepare the Butter Mixture
In a small mixing bowl, combine unsalted butter, honey, garlic powder, smoked paprika, salt, and black pepper. Mix until smooth and set aside.
Step 2: Cook the Chicken
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Add the chicken breasts, cooking for 5-6 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through (internal temperature should reach 165°F).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.
Step 3: Deglaze the Pan
In the same skillet, pour in the chicken broth. Use it to deglaze the pan by scraping up any bits stuck to the bottom. Stir in the butter mixture and cook until smooth.
Step 4: Coat the Chicken with Sauce
Return the cooked chicken to the skillet. Coat it thoroughly with the buttery sauce. Let it simmer for 2-3 minutes so that it can absorb all those wonderful flavors.
Step 5: Serve Your Dish
Garnish with fresh chopped parsley before serving. Enjoy your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et warm!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Cooking can be straightforward, but certain common mistakes can ruin your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et. Here are some pitfalls to watch out for:
- Bold preparation: Not preparing your ingredients before starting can lead to chaos. Have everything measured and ready to go for a smooth cooking experience.
- Bold heat management: Cooking chicken on too high heat can result in burnt outsides and raw insides. Always cook on medium heat for even cooking.
- Bold skipping the sauce: Forgetting to deglaze the pan with broth means losing rich flavors. Always scrape up those tasty bits for an enhanced sauce.
- Bold ignoring resting time: Cutting into chicken immediately after cooking can dry it out. Allow it to rest for a few minutes before slicing for juicy results.
- Bold insufficient seasoning: Under-seasoning can make your dish bland. Taste as you go and adjust seasonings to suit your palate for a flavorful dish.

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
- Let the dish cool completely before sealing to prevent condensation.
Freezing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et
- Freeze in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months.
- Divide into portions for easy thawing.
Reheating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et
- Bold oven: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Place in an oven-safe dish covered with foil until heated through (about 20-25 minutes).
- Bold microwave: Heat in a microwave-safe bowl on medium power, stirring occasionally, until warmed (about 3-5 minutes).
- Bold stovetop: Reheat in a skillet over low heat, stirring gently until warmed through.

Can I use other meats in the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et?
You can absolutely substitute chicken with turkey or beef for a different flavor profile while keeping the recipe easy and delicious.
How do I make this recipe spicier?
For extra heat, consider adding crushed red pepper flakes or cayenne pepper to the butter mixture before cooking.
What side dishes pair well with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et?
This dish pairs wonderfully with steamed vegetables, rice, or a fresh salad for a complete meal.
Can I prepare this dish ahead of time?
Yes! You can prepare the sauce and marinate the chicken ahead of time; just cook it fresh when you’re ready to serve.
